[infinispan-commits] Infinispan SVN: r2332 - bran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ote.

infinispan-commits at lists.jboss.org infinispan-commits at lists.jboss.org
Tue Sep 7 06:45:34 EDT 2010


Author: mircea.markus
Date: 2010-09-07 06:45:33 -0400 (Tue, 07 Sep 2010)
New Revision: 2332

Modified:
   bran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reFunctionalTest.java
   bran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reTest.java
Log:
better test cleanup

Modified: bran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reFunctionalTest.java
===================================================================
--- bran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reFunctionalTest.java	2010-09-06 22:39:58 UTC (rev 2331)
+++ bran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reFunctionalTest.java	2010-09-07 10:45:33 UTC (rev 2332)
@@ -6,7 +6,10 @@
 import org.infinispan.manager.CacheContainer;
 import org.infinispan.manager.EmbeddedCacheManager;
 import org.infinispan.server.hotrod.HotRodServer;
+import org.infinispan.test.TestingUtil;
 import org.infinispan.test.fwk.TestCacheManagerFactory;
+import org.testng.annotations.AfterClass;
+import org.testng.annotations.AfterMethod;
 import org.testng.annotations.AfterTest;
 import org.testng.annotations.Test;
 
@@ -35,10 +38,10 @@
       return remoteCacheStoreConfig;
    }
 
-   @AfterTest
+   @AfterMethod(alwaysRun = true)
    public void tearDown() {
       hrServer.stop();
-      localCacheManager.stop();
+      TestingUtil.killCacheManagers(localCacheManager);
    }
 
    @Override

Modified: bran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reTest.java
===================================================================
--- bran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reTest.java	2010-09-06 22:39:58 UTC (rev 2331)
+++ branches/4.2.x/cachestore/remote/src/test/java/org/infinispan/loaders/remote/RemoteCacheStoreTest.java	2010-09-07 10:45:33 UTC (rev 2332)
@@ -9,6 +9,7 @@
 import org.infinispan.manager.EmbeddedCacheManager;
 import org.infinispan.server.hotrod.HotRodServer;
 import org.infinispan.test.fwk.TestCacheManagerFactory;
+import org.testng.annotations.AfterMethod;
 import org.testng.annotations.AfterTest;
 import org.testng.annotations.Test;
 
@@ -45,7 +46,7 @@
       return remoteCacheStore;
    }
 
-   @AfterTest(alwaysRun = true)
+   @AfterMethod(alwaysRun = true)
    public void tearDown() {
       hrServer.stop();
       localCacheManager.stop();



More information about the infinispan-commits mailing list